Microsoft to Raise US Xbox Prices between $20 and $70 on Oct. 3
NegativeTechnology
Microsoft has announced a price hike for its Xbox Series S and Series X consoles, set to take effect on October 3. The increase, which ranges from $20 to $70, is attributed to shifts in the macroeconomic landscape. This move could impact gamers' purchasing decisions and reflects broader trends in the gaming industry, where rising costs are becoming a concern.
